General Illumination LUXEON Z UV Superior flux density, efficiency and design freedom — in the industry’s only micro-package UV LED At 1/5th the size of other ultraviolet and violet LEDs, LUXEON Z UV LEDs, a SMT device, can be assembled in tight arrays with spacing of only 200 microns, which enables high power density (W/cm2) system for superior efficiency and design freedom. The product is undomed for precise optical control, and a portfolio covering ultraviolet and violet light. Open the catalog to page 2General Information Test Conditions LUXEON Z UV emitters are specified and binned at 500mA, 20ms monopulse, and junction temperature of 25°C. Product Nomenclature The part number designation for LUXEON Z UV is as follows: L H UV – a B B B – c D D D Where: a — open slot to accommodate additional requirements per product and part number. a is 0 by default BBB — designates beginning of 5nm wavelength bin (for example, 395 for 395-400nm) c — open slot to accommodate additional requirements per product and part number. c is 0 by default DDD — designates minimum radiometric power in mW (for example,...
